About

Heeseung Bang is a leading researcher in the transformative field of emerging mobility systems, with a focus on connected and automated vehicles (CAVs), shared mobility, and electric vehicles. His work bridges the critical gap between theoretical control algorithms and real-world deployment, primarily through the development of innovative small-scale robotic testbeds. Bang’s most impactful contribution is his creation of a research and educational testbed that enables real-time control of these complex systems, allowing researchers to validate theories through scaled experiments—a work that has garnered 35 citations. He has also authored a comprehensive survey on small-scale testbeds for CAVs and robot swarms, serving as an essential guide for the community. Beyond physical testbeds, Bang has developed a digital smart city simulation environment using Unity, providing a high-fidelity virtual space for testing mobility solutions. His notable achievements include pioneering a scalable last-mile delivery service, demonstrated from simulation to scaled experiment, showcasing his commitment to solving practical transportation challenges. Through his integrated approach of theory, simulation, and physical experimentation, Bang is accelerating the safe and efficient integration of automated vehicles into our transportation networks.
